Coppery Emerald vs Northern Treeshrew
Chlorostilbon russatus compared with Tupaia belangeri
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Coppery Emerald | Northern Treeshrew |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Aves (Birds)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Apodiformes (Apodiformes) | Scandentia (Scandentia) |
| Family | Trochilidae | Tupaiidae |
| Genus | Chlorostilbon | Tupaia |
| Species | Chlorostilbon russatus | Tupaia belangeri |
Evolutionary Relationship
Coppery Emerald and Northern Treeshrew share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
